88th anniversary of Castlecary rail disaster

EDM (Early Day Motion) 2707: tabled on 29 January 2026

Tabled in the 2024-26 session.

This motion has been signed by 6 Members. It has not yet had any amendments submitted.

Motion text

That this House marks the 88th anniversary of the Castlecary rail disaster of December 1937, in which 35 people lost their lives and 179 others were injured; remembers with deep respect those who died, including many service personnel travelling home for Christmas leave, and extends its sympathies to their families and descendants; pays tribute to the emergency responders and local residents who assisted at the scene; recognises the longstanding efforts of the local community to ensure the tragedy is not forgotten, including the Castlecary Community Council and Councillor William Buchanan, who throughout his dedicated long-term service to the community has played a key role in commemorating the disaster; welcomes the memorial in Castlecary Gardens as a lasting reminder of the human cost of rail disasters; and reaffirms the importance of remembrance and continued commitment to rail safety.
